oracle 11新增数据源,在数据源中如何添加和使用参数

本文主要介绍在不同的数据源中如何添加和使用参数

OLEDB

1.打开报表设计器2.创建一个新的页面报表或者RDL报表

3.添加新的数据源

4.连接类型使用Microsoft OLEDB提供并作为OLE DB提供程序使用Microsoft.Jet.OLEDB.4.0

5.填写连接信息数据库(如NWIND.MDB)并保存数据源

6.添加新的DataSet

7.在查询页面中,插入SQL表达式,(例如. "SELECT * FROM Customers WHERE (Country = ? AND City = ?)")

8.单击“验证”,以验证查询

9.进入“参数”对话框中的数据集的标签,例如:添加参数1和参数2

10.设置为参数值“ = [@参数1 ]”和“ = [@参数2 ] ”相应

11.保存数据集

ODBC

1.步骤1-3的与OLEDB相同

2.连接类型使用微软ODBC提供 3.填写连接字符串(例如. "Driver={Microsoft Access Driver (*.mdb)};DBQ=c:\NWIND.mdb")并保存数据源

4.添加新的DataSet

5.在查询选项卡插入SQL表达式(例如,“ SELECT * FROM 客户 WHERE (国家= @参数1 and 城市= @参数2 ) ” )

6.步骤8-11的与OLEDB相同

SQL Client

1.步骤1-3的与OLEDB相同

2.连接类型使用Microsoft Sql Client Provider

3.填写连接字符串(例如. "user id=sa;data source=192.168.33.45;initial catalog=NWIND;password=123;"),在“连接属性”选项卡中设置“保存密码”复选框,并保存数据源

4.添加新的DataSet

5.在查询选项卡插入SQL表达式(例如,“ SELECT * FROM 客户 WHERE (国家= @参数1 and 城市= @参数2 ) ” )

6.步骤8-11的与OLEDB相同

OracleDB

1.步骤1-3的与OLEDB相同

2.连接类型使用Oracle Client Provider

3.填写连接字符串(例如. "User Id=admin;Password=1;Data Source=oraserver:1521/xe;"),在“连接属性”选项卡中设置“保存密码”复选框,并保存数据源

4.添加新的DataSet

5.在查询选项卡插入SQL表达式(例如,“ SELECT * FROM 客户 WHERE (国家= :参数1 and 城市= :参数2 ) ” )

6.步骤8-11的与OLEDB相同

您在使用产品过程中有任何疑问,可以登录官方产品技术社区和经验丰富的技术工程师、ActiveReports开发人员交流:了解更多。

了解ActiveReports产品更多特性:

下载产品体验产品功能:

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值